Brief introduction of Fuliang County

The floating beam is located in the northeast of Jiangxi Province, under the jurisdiction of Jingdezhen City, at the junction of Jiangxi and Anhui provinces. It is one of the 38 key counties (cities, districts) in Poyang Lake Eco-economic Zone, and it is an efficient and intensive development zone. Fuliang County covers an area of 285 1 km2, and the cultivated land area is 27 1 10,000 mu. Jurisdiction over 9 towns and 8 townships. The total population is 300,000 (20 10), of which the rural population is 247,500. The landform is mountainous, hilly and plain, and there are many rivers. It belongs to the humid weather in the middle subtropical zone. The annual average temperature is 17℃ and the annual precipitation is 1764 mm. There are abundant reserves of placer gold, coal, porcelain clay, marble, limestone and fluorite. The local specialty is "one porcelain and two teas": Jingdezhen, a world-famous porcelain capital, has long been under the jurisdiction of Fuliang County in history, so Fuliang is known as the "source of the world porcelain capital"; Fuliang tea in the Tang Dynasty is also famous all over the world. In Dunhuang's suicide note "On Tea and Wine" and Bai Juyi's "Pipa Trip", the reputations of "Floating Beam Zhou She, All Nations Come to Seek" and "Whoever gets rich first, has no intention to keep her, and went to Floating Beam to buy tea a month ago" were left respectively. 20 1 1 year, the gross domestic product (GDP) of Fuliang County is 6.462 billion yuan.
